Vintage Japanese 78 RPM Records 

This is a set of two vintage Japanese 78 rpm records by the Nitto Record company. One record features two songs performed by Tachibanaya Senyu such as Oiwake. The other record features songs performed by Rikimatsu Shuzo. The record numbers are 1247 and 301. These items were not tested.

  • Black
  • C1930
  • Some characters on the labels: 追分 Oiwake (song title), 追降りて行く 三十三所御詠歌 Tsuioriteyuku Sanjyusansho goeika (song title), 立花家扇遊 Tachibanaya Senyu, 二上新内(乃木将軍) (song title), 鎗さび (song title), 南地 力松 秀三 Nanchi Rikimatsu Shuzo
